Checklist for Bootle-Specific Security
1. Verify SIA-Licensed Security Providers
In the UK, SIA-licensed security guards are the only individuals who can lawfully work on retail premises, at events, or on private property. They undergo training in conflict management, law, and first aid. These skills can turn a dangerous situation into a safe resolution.
With Bootle’s violent and public order crime rates higher than average, having licensed guards offers effective risk control.
2. Assess Your Local Crime Profile
Log in to postcode-specific tools, such as Crystal Roof and StreetCheck, to view local risks. L20 and L30 postcodes tend to have high rates of violence, criminal damage, and drug offences.
For instance, if burglary reports are high in your postcode, you can organise evening patrols or improve alarm cover. It is a much more effective strategy than receiving generic recommendations.
3. Map Your Business Against Bootle Crime Hotspots
Verify your location against local incident data, using crime statistics. In February 2025, public order incidents clustered around:
- Oakhouse Park
- Retail areas near Stanley Road
- Sefton Business Park
If you are within these areas, consider layered protection, such as manned guarding, combined with a comprehensive Bootle security audit to identify weak points.
4. Install Layered Security: Static Guards + Alarms
Bootle retail security requires more than just cameras. Shoplifting, vandalism, and public disorder are frequent issues where a uniformed presence, backed by an alarm system, ensures both prevention and a rapid response.
Static guards prevent opportunistic crime, and alarm systems notify your provider for immediate action. It acts as a winning combination proven to cut losses and damage.
5. Plan Mobile Patrols for L20/L30 Areas
Mobile patrols are exceptionally efficient in postcodes such as L20–3BE and L30–1RD, where business crime trends indicate a higher-than-average risk of crime.
These roaming teams keep burglars guessing, making them ideal for warehouses, office parks, and sites with multiple points of entry.
6. Integrate CCTV and Alarm with Guard Dispatch
Technology is only as effective as your response time. Connecting CCTV and alarms directly to your security provider means that if there is activity at 2 a.m., a Security guard will be dispatched.
In high-incident locations such as Stanley Road or the perimeter of Oakhouse Park, every second counts.
7. Tailor Guard Schedules to Local Risk Patterns
All hours are not created equal when it comes to risk. Evenings and late nights near shopping areas, residential estates, and office parks are prime windows for anti-social activity.
A local security firm can coordinate shifts with crime cycles. It can be an additional coverage on payday weekends or late-night events.
8. Strengthen Event or Retail Zone Security
Bootle’s Strand Shopping Centre is halfway to completing its multi-million-pound makeover. With more visitors expected, retail and event security needs to be increased.
Event-quality static or roaming security staff can handle crowd control, safeguard your stock, and provide assistance during emergencies without compromising the personal atmosphere of your premises.

10. Offer Property-Specific Risk Assessment
A generic checklist cannot serve as a substitute for an adapted inspection. Local providers frequently provide free or low-cost on-site audits that include:
- Optimal guard positioning: Analyse pedestrian and vehicle traffic to position guards where risk exposure is most significant. Align patrol courses with entry points, cash handling areas, and high-value areas to discourage incidents. Employ sightlines and cluster coverage to maximise deterrence while minimising response times.
- Camera blind spot checks: Plot all exit/entrance points, as well as important interior spaces, to identify blind spots. Mimic typical incident routes to verify cameras get clear, usable footage. Suggest changes or additions to angles, heights, or lenses to close the gaps.
- Access point vulnerabilities: Inspect door, gate, and entry controls for built-in vulnerabilities. Evaluate external vs. internal access threats, including maintenance and service paths. Recommend layered protections (physical obstructions, alarm incorporation, and access recording) to seal gaps.
- Lighting coverage: Review exterior and interior lighting to discourage concealment and enhance camera performance. Identify dark areas around doors, perimeters, and parking lots that require an upgrade. Suggest lighting intensities and fixture locations that strike a balance between security and energy efficiency.
A property-specific report doesn’t simply make you feel better; it provides you with a plan of action.
